Architectural Renderings: Construction and Manual Design edited by Fabio Schillaci is an authoritative guide to the art and craft of architectural visualization. The book covers a broad spectrum of rendering techniques — from traditional pencil and ink methods to contemporary digital workflows — enabling architects and designers to communicate their ideas with clarity and artistry. Each chapter breaks down the process of representing light, shadow, materials, and spatial depth with precision and style.
